Mamello Mofokeng becomes the first South African woman to compete at the International Olympiad on Financial Security in Russia

Mamello Mofokeng, a trailblazing final-year Bachelor of Science in Life Sciences (Microbiology) with Business Management student at the University of South Africa (UNISA) and CEO of Saturated, has made history by becoming the first South African woman to compete at the prestigious International Olympiad on Financial Security in Sochi, Russia.

Mofokeng’s participation in this global event is a testament to her exceptional talent, unwavering dedication, and the supportive academic environment at UNISA. Her achievement underscores the university’s commitment to fostering a diverse range of talent and empowering its students to excel on the international stage.

The International Olympiad on Financial Security is a highly competitive event that brings together the world’s most promising young minds to address critical issues such as money laundering, cybercrime, and terrorist financing. Mofokeng’s presence at this event not only highlights her individual brilliance but also underscores South Africa’s increasing role in the global fight against financial crime.

By participating in this prestigious international competition, Mofokeng has opened doors for future generations of South African students. Her achievement inspires young women to pursue careers in STEM fields and demonstrates the power of education to drive positive change.
